Telstar 18 Satellite Reaches Its Orbital Position

Loral Space & Communications announced today that the Telstar 18 satellite has reached its intended orbital position and still has enough fuel to last for its designed 13 year lifetime. An anomoly caused the Zenit-3SL launcher to shut down 54 seconds early on 28 June, leaving the satellite in a lower than intended orbit. Operators used the stationkeeping fuel margin to boost the spacecraft to its proper orbit. The satellite is currently undergoing in-orbit testing and should be operationally deployed in August.
